That success always comes from growth. With most businesses, growth comes from customer retention and gaining new customers. “Business Intelligence” can help a company gain new customers and retain old customers. Business intelligence can be abbreviated BI. A formal definition of business intelligence is that it is a process of collecting information in the area of business. In BI, data collected is enhanced into information and then into knowledge. Business Intelligence can give any business an accurate idea of its customers’ needs. Businesses that have large amounts of information about their customers can act upon that information. Businesses utilizing BI gain knowledge and understanding of a customer’s needs, customer’s decision-making process, and economic, cultural, and technological trends.
